China must be careful over forex rate- Premier Wen

China must be careful before changing its fixed exchange rate because any rash change could mean trouble for the economy and that of the rest of the world, Premier Wen Jiabao said in an interview on Wednesday 28 April.

``As to how and when this (reform) can be started, we must be very prudent,'' Wen told Reuters in an interview on the eve of an official trip to Europe.
